What to know about Encryption
Encryption plays a crucial role in protecting digital information from unauthorized access, ensuring privacy and data security in an increasingly connected world. This tag gathers diverse stories on encryption technologies, strategies, and challenges faced by enterprises and individuals alike.
Recent discussions highlight the rising adoption of quantum-safe encryption, cloud-based key management solutions, and zero trust architectures, reflecting the evolving cybersecurity landscape. Companies such as DigiCert, Entrust, Gemalto, and others are actively advancing encryption offerings to prepare for emerging threats like quantum computing and sophisticated malware leveraging encrypted channels.
Readers exploring this tag can learn about innovations in encryption software and hardware, the importance of encryption in data protection regulations, and the complexities of managing encrypted traffic to prevent security blind spots. The collection also emphasizes the critical balance between privacy, regulatory compliance, and safeguarding against malicious actors who exploit encryption.
